JEi Track Cars Build v1.0
1970 Porsche 914/6


0-60   5.422
0-100   13.103
top speed   141.0

braking
95.0
254.2

cornering
1.13
1.11

Upgrades:
Street Intake
Race Exhaust
Street Fuel System
Sport Cams & Valves
Race Engine Block
Hoosier Race Slicks 225/35R17
Volk TE37
Race Weight Reduction
Full Race Platform & Handling
Forza Race Rear Wing

Settings:
Tires   29/30
F.D. 3.30
1st   2.84
2nd   1.85
3rd   1.40
4rth   1.17
5th   1.03
6th   0.92

Camber -.8/-.5
Toe      0/0
Caster   5.0
ARBs   15.04/15.03
Springs   258.7/329.3
Ride      4.7/4.7
Rebound   6.7/6.7
Bump      3.7/3.7
Aero      80lbs
Braking      48% Front Bias / 100% pressure
Differential   65%/90%

Note: I've only tested this setup on Tsukuba for sprints of less than 10 laps.  I will continue working on this setup some to ensure that it works on other circuits and in longer races.

Hmm, interesting. Much like the bazdc2 Dino, you're running soft in the front compared to what BBB is suggesting should be the ideal. I'm also a little surprised that you run so much grip. I had considered acceleration to be as important as grip on this track, but your 914 is no drag-racer.

Nice job.

Do you have any thoughts about what could be improved upon as far as handling dynamics?
